Background:caution:Do not confuse oligodendrocyte-myelin glycoprotein (OMG) with myelin-oligodendrocyte glycoprotein (MOG).,function:Cell adhesion molecule contributing to the interactive process required for myelination in the central nervous system.,PTM:O-glycosylated in its Ser/Thr-rich repeat domain .,similarity:Contains 8 LRR (leucine-rich) repeats.,subunit:Binds to RTN4R.,tissue specificity:Oligodendrocytes and myelin of the central nervous system.,

Subcellular Location:Cell membrane; Lipid-anchor, GPI-anchor.
Expression:Oligodendrocytes and myelin of the central nervous system.
